Method: Sentry::Event#rack_env=

Defined in:
lib/sentry/event.rb

#rack_env=(env) ⇒ void

This method returns an undefined value.

Sets the event’s request environment data with RequestInterface.

Parameters:

  • env (Hash)

See Also:

[View source]

107
108
109
110
111
112
113
114
115
116
117
# File 'lib/sentry/event.rb', line 107

def rack_env=(env)
  unless request || env.empty?
    add_request_interface(env)

    user[:ip_address] ||= calculate_real_ip_from_rack(env) if @send_default_pii

    if request_id = Utils::RequestId.read_from(env)
      tags[:request_id] = request_id
    end
  end
end